== English == === Alternative forms === fœderation (obsolete) === Etymology === Borrowed from French fédération, from Late Latin foederatio, from Latin foederare; equivalent to federate +‎ -ion. === Pronunciation === (Received Pronunciation, General American) IPA(key): /ˌfɛdəˈɹeɪ̯ʃən/, [ˌfɛdəˈɹeɪ̯ʃən] ~ [ˌfɛdəˈɹeɪ̯ʃn̩] (General Australian) IPA(key): /ˌfɛdəˈɹæɪ̯ʃən/, [ˌfɛdəˈɹæ̝ɪ̯ʃən] ~ [ˌfɛdəˈɹæ̝ɪ̯ʃn̩] Rhymes: -eɪʃən Hyphenation: fed‧e‧ra‧tion === Noun === federation (countable and uncountable, plural federations) An act of joining together into a single political entity. An array of nations or states that are unified under one central authority. Synonyms: federal state; see also Thesaurus:federal country Coordinate terms: confederation, confederacy, supranational union Any society or organisation formed from separate groups or bodies. (computing, telecommunications) A collection of network or telecommunication providers that offer interoperability. ==== Derived terms ==== ==== Related terms ==== ==== Descendants ==== → Burmese: ဖယ်ဒရေးရှင်း (hpaida.re:hrang:) ==== Translations ==== === Adjective === federation (not comparable) (Australia) Of an architectural style popular around the time of federation. == Danish == === Noun === federation c (singular definite federationen, plural indefinite federationer) unofficial form of føderation ==== Declension ==== ==== Synonyms ==== forbundsstat == Swedish == === Noun === federation c federation; an array of states or nations ==== Declension ==== ==== Related terms ==== federal
